Transaction 8bdfc4c7503cea2ff2c2843e7b77e172258447060f745ad92af0485efeca3351
1 Input
1 Output
-
8bdfc4c7503cea2ff2c2843e7b77e172258447060f745ad92af0485efeca3351:0
- value
- 23429552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 043cd48bb32fb48f8a995977674a42970e0e9751 OP_EQUAL
- address
- 325RVsVf5oc51jGLnXtnKBy6eeVC9AiofJ